I want to thank you for the great job your crew did aboard the USS Constellation. The lead paint stabilization project presented us with a couple of big problems. Being a museum, which relies on admissions for most of our funding, there was no way we could close the ship to visitors. ARC’s innovative construction of an airlock passage in the ship’s forward ladderway made it possible to have visitors on the upper decks while your team worked safely below.

Although the overall complexity of Constellation’s 1854 construction details was a huge challenge for ARC, you were able to remove the lead paint from areas that we thought were inaccessible. It is truly wonderful to have the entire ship open to the public again for the first time in a decade.
